The former president of Mannar gram panchayat, Sridevi Amma, was tragically found dead in her home after falling victim to a financial fraud. She was known for her community service and had served as a member and president of the panchayat. The incident has shocked the local community, with an ongoing investigation into the fraud. Sridevi Amma leaves behind her husband and children, who are based in the USA and Kuwait. The funeral will be held soon, with many mourning her untimely passing. The details of the fraud reveal a troubling scheme that took advantage of her generosity and trust.

The sudden and tragic death of Sridevi Amma has shocked the residents of Mannar and surrounding areas. Known for her dedication to public service and community welfare, Sridevi Amma’s passing has left a void in the hearts of many who knew her. Her untimely demise has also brought to light the dangers of financial fraud and the need for vigilance when dealing with monetary transactions.

Sridevi Amma’s involvement in the scam, where she was duped of lakhs of rupees by a group of women, including a former gram panchayat member, has raised concerns about the vulnerability of individuals, especially the elderly, to financial exploitation. The modus operandi of the fraudsters, who initially gained Sridevi Amma’s trust by returning small amounts of money with interest, highlights the need for caution when dealing with unknown individuals promising quick returns on investments.

The impact of the scam on Sridevi Amma’s family, including her husband Sukumara Kurup and children residing abroad, has been devastating. The emotional and financial burden of the loss has left them grappling with the aftermath of the fraud and the tragic death of their loved one. The funeral arrangements, set to take place tomorrow at the family’s residence, will be a somber occasion as friends, family, and well-wishers gather to pay their respects.
